DEGREE REQUIREMENTS
Total Credits Required: 90
This degree gives students the opportunity to make substantial progress toward fulfilling major requirements while completing at least half of the Breadth requirements for Humanities and Social Science. Completing the AS-T degree will prepare students for upper division study; it does not guarantee students admission to the major. The college recommends that the student identify one or two potential transfer schools and then contact qualified program advisors at those institutions as early as possible to obtain specific, course-by-course advice.

Engineering Transfer (AS-T Track 2) Pre-Requisite Flow Chart
Start by meeting with your advisor to determine which course to take first based on your placement scores.
English Pathway
ENGL 99: English Skills + CSS 106: Reading Skills → ENGL&101: Composition I → ENGL&102: Composition II
Math Pathway
DVS 080: College Transitions Math → MATH 094: Intro to Algebra → MATH 098: Intermediate Algebra I → MATH 099: Intermediate Algebra I and MATH&146: Intro to Stats
Math-Calculus Pathway
MATH 099: Intermediate Algebra I → MATH&141: Pre-Calculus I → MATH&142: Pre-Calculus II → MATH&151: Calculus I → MATH&152: Calculus II → MATH&163: Calculus III (W, Sp) → MATH 230:Differential Equations (Sp) and MATH&254: Calculus IV (F)
Chemistry Pathway
MATH 099: Intermediate Algebra I → CHEM&161: General Chem I (F) with BIOL&221: Majors Eco/Evo → CHEM&162: General Chem II (W) → CHEM&163: General Chem III (Sp)
Biology Pathway
MATH 099: Intermediate Algebra I → BIOL&221: Majors Eco/Evo with CHEM&161: General Chem I (F) → BIOL&222: Majors Cell Molecular (W)
Engineering Physics Pathway
MATH&151: Calculus I → PHYS&221: Engineering Physics I (F) → PHYS&222: Engineering Physics II (W) → PHYS&223: Engineering Physics III (Sp)
KEY: F = Fall, W = Winter, Sp = Spring, Su = Summer

Fall, Winter, Spring, or Summer. However the Chemistry and Physics series are offered once a year beginning Fall quarter.
This program can be completed on campus or hybrid. Courses are offered on-campus, online, or hybrid (part on-campus, part online). Most STEM courses are in-person while some Math courses are hybrid.
90+ Credits = 6 Quarters* if you take 15 credits each quarter
*Your specific route may take longer than 6 quarters depending on the number of credits you take each quarter and where you start in your math and English pathways.
At a basic level, engineers apply scientific and mathematical principles to make the world a better place. They may design machines, roads, building, or circuitry; combine the inventions of others to develop or improve processes; oversee the operation of technological equipment in facilities ranging from waste treatment plants to large manufacturing facilities to water purification plants; develop new materials that are stronger, lighter, or more environmentally friendly.
The AS-T 2 Pre-Engineering degreе path allows students to prepare for upper divisions study toward a Bachelor of Science degree in engineering and enter the college or university at junior standing, should they be admitted to the school’s engineering program.
